A division of leading entertainment and sports agency Creative Artists Agency (CAA), CAA ICON is the industry’s-leading owner's representative and strategic management consulting firm for public and private sports and entertainment facility owners/operators, professional franchises, and leagues. With more than 65 sports, entertainment, and public assembly projects and over 2,500 consulting engagements, CAA ICON has managed the development of many of the most successful venues around the world. Our experience spans 11 professional sports leagues and has totaled nearly $45 billion over the last 20 years in business. CAA ICON offers world-class service in the areas of feasibility and planning, project management, consulting, and beyond.
The Role
This position is part of CAA’s global HR team and is focused on supporting CAA ICON, a division of CAA Sports.
In this role, reporting to the Senior Director of HR, the HR Coordinator will help support CAA ICON’s growing team. This support includes, but is not limited to, general administrative duties and culture-related initiatives, and is responsible for people administration via multiple systems, including Workday, as well as coordinating administration across the full employee life cycle. The HR Coordinator is a key resource for all CAA ICON employees in North America. This role also has responsibilities involving CAA ICON’s UK and Italy staff.
Responsibilities
- Provide administrative support to the Senior HR Director and Learning & Development Director, including calendar management, meeting coordination, travel arrangements, and expense reporting.
- Support the Learning & Development Director in coordinating training initiatives and programs.
- Manage administrative tasks related to onboarding, new hire orientation, employee announcements, and exit processes. This includes entering and auditing data in the HRIS (Workday), ensuring compliance, and completing/verifying Form I-9 documentation. Also responsible for new hire swag (ordering, sending, and inventory management).
- Oversee the CAA ICON summer internship program, including:
- Planning and executing the onboarding week in the Denver office for all interns, regardless of work location. This includes creating a proposed budget, conducting onboarding sessions, coordinating executive meetings, introducing the capstone project, and organizing volunteer and social events.
- Coordinating a 13-week Summer Speaker Series by securing executive presenters, scheduling sessions, and managing recordings.
- Conducting regular check-ins with interns, their supervisors, and other stakeholders to assess progress and provide feedback.
- Planning and organizing end-of-summer capstone presentations, exit interviews, and offboarding.
- Coordinate CAA ICON company-wide "WeConnect" collaborations and partner with others on committee initiatives (e.g., DE&I, Women's Group, volunteer events).
- Develop and execute employee engagement initiatives, such as regular check-ins, workshops, and positive employee relations efforts. Foster a culture of connection by maintaining strong relationships with employees across the organization.
- Maintain digital personnel files and ensure accurate and compliant data entry and document storage in the HRIS (Workday).
- Manage the employee recognition program and coordinate acknowledgments for personal milestones (e.g., births, bereavement).
- Prepare various forms of correspondence, including personalized messages for birthdays and work anniversaries.
- Respond to employee inquiries and requests, providing timely and professional customer service.
- Assist in tracking data and documentation related to the recruitment cycle.
- Maintain internal HR and operations resources, and track key employee events such as leaves of absence, performance reviews, and required training completion.
- Collaborates with other Assistants at CAA ICON to plan and implement local and all CAA ICON events (i.e., summer picnic, all employee meetings, etc.).
- Other related duties as apparent or assigned.
